March for Life 2024
- The annual March for Life took place in Washington, D.C. on January 19, 2024.
- Thousands marched from the Capitol to the Supreme Court, energized by the overturning of Roe v. Wade.
Third-Party Suppression
- Democratic opposition research firm, American Bridge, is working to suppress third-party candidates.
- They aim to keep groups like No Labels and Robert F. Kennedy Jr. off the ballot in key states.
Willis Misconduct Hearing
- A judge set a hearing date for alleged misconduct by Fulton County DA Fani Willis.
- Co-defendant Michael Roman accuses Willis of a romantic relationship with a special prosecutor in the Trump case.
